Output ec6d69aba8e74cefc91c23656d8e72ddd0c9fb8a7f68f676c8df4250786918bc:1

value
2806268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32039ad28057ed771458a005f75e47355371b3a7 OP_EQUAL
address
36FU2bidLUiVUZMzKDnePftDUfnQ4x3dbH
transaction
ec6d69aba8e74cefc91c23656d8e72ddd0c9fb8a7f68f676c8df4250786918bc
confirmations
240855
spent
true